Address 590.45428199 DOGE

DL5vUqkrZDE6EgZCyaGUwWxKMNZ3wMvfp4

Confirmed

Total Received590.45428199 DOGE
Total Sent0 DOGE
Final Balance590.45428199 DOGE
No. Transactions1

Transactions

Fee: 0.966 DOGE
157529 Confirmations1180.96153737 DOGE